Easy Make Ahead Breakfast Burritos

These easy make ahead breakfast burritos are quick, easy, and freezer friendly! A flour tortilla stuffed with sausage, eggs, cheese, and veggies! A perfect on-the-go breakfast.

Prep

10 min

Cook

15 min

Total

25 min

Serves

8

Instructions

  1. 01

    Heat a large non-stick sauté pan over medium heat.

  2. 02

    Once hot, add in sausage, onion, and bell peppers.

  3. 03

    Cook, breaking up the meat as you go, until the sausage is no longer pink and the peppers are tender.

  4. 04

    Season with salt and pepper, to taste, then remove from pan and set aside in a large bowl.

  5. 05

    In the same pan, add in whisked eggs. Cook until the eggs are scrambled to your liking, then season with salt and pepper.

  6. 06

    Place the eggs into the large bowl with the meat mixture and stir to combine.

  7. 07

    Assemble the burritos: scoop meat/egg mixture (about 3/4 cups) onto a tortilla, top with 2 tablespoons of cheese, and roll. Repeat with remaining ingredients.

  8. 08

    Bake immediately (425 degrees F for about 10 minutes) or store for later.*
